Job description

Job Description

At Arconic, we are looking for people who share our values of integrity, inclusion, and diversity, and who demonstrate agility, results commitment, and the capability to grow themselves and others. In return, we offer the opportunity to Grow Together with ongoing opportunities for professional growth provided by a constantly changing environment, working alongside employees who value the people they work with just as much as the work they do.

Primary Responsibilities
  • Build infrastructure health dashboards utilizing visualization tool
  • Work with metrics and monitoring data for log collection
  • Define thresholds to represent current state of infrastructure solution
  • Document dashboard and reporting processes
  • Collaborate with IT teams to build requirements and to demo progress
  • Operate with Arconic IS standards and conventions and applicable Arconic BU/RU IT Standards
Key Objectives
  • Build infrastructure and application dashboards to monitor the health of IT systems
  • Learn and apply the applicable toolsets to solve real world business problems
  • Add value to the company through key IT project and task deliverables
  • Bring a new perspective and new ideas to IT efforts and processes
  • Communicate professionally and effectively with a wide variety of people, via face to face, over the phone, via email, via Microsoft Teams and in writing
Basic Qualifications
  • Credits toward a bachelor’s degree in IS/IT or similar, from an accredited institution
  • Relevant IT course work completed successfully
  • Basic understanding of servers, databases, networking and IT infrastructure technologies
  • Must have an expected graduation date in Fall 2027, Spring/Summer of 2028, or, Spring/Summer of 2029
  • Current cumulative GPA of 3.0 or greater
  • Employees must be legally authorized to work in the United States. Verification of employment eligibility will be required at the time of hire. Visa sponsorship is not available for this position.
  • This position is subject to the International Traffic in Arms Regulations (ITAR) which requires U.S. person status. ITAR defines U.S> person as a U.S> citizen, U.S> Permanent Resident (i.e. ‘Green Card Holder), Political Asylee, or Refugee.
Preferred Qualifications
  • Experience with reporting or data analysis
  • Familiarity with scripting (PowerShell, Python or similar)
  • Strong problem solving and communication skills
  • Prior work experience in an IT role
  • Leadership experience
About Us

Arconic Corporation is a leading provider of aluminum sheet, plate and extrusions, as well as innovative architectural products, that advance the automotive, aerospace, commercial transportation, industrial and building and construction markets. Building on more than a century of innovation, Arconic helps to transform the way we fly, drive, and build.
